Alternatives
- Microsoft Media Creation Tool (official for Windows 10/11).
- Microsoft’s Download Windows 10/11 ISOs pages.
- Windows Update and Volume Licensing Service Center for enterprise customers.
- Rufus (for writing ISOs to USB) — official Rufus site recommended.

If you've ever needed to download official Windows ISOs, drivers, or UEFI firmware directly from Microsoft's servers — without the bloat of the Media Creation Tool — you've likely come across TechBench by wzt.
